From Homelessness to NFL Stardom: The Josh Jacobs Story
Born Joshua Cordell Jacobs on February 11, 1998, in Tulsa, Oklahoma, Jacobs endured a childhood marked by hardship. From the age of eight until he started college, Jacobs and his siblings lived with his single father, Marty, often sleeping in a car or bouncing between rundown apartments. Football became his escape and his path to a better life. Despite the instability, Jacobs excelled at McLain High School in Tulsa, earning his way to the University of Alabama, where he became a key contributor to the Crimson Tide's powerhouse program.

At Alabama, Jacobs was a versatile weapon in the backfield, helping the Crimson Tide win the 2017 College Football Playoff National Championship. He declared for the NFL Draft after his junior season and was selected by the Oakland Raiders in the first round, 24th overall, in 2019 — a remarkable rise from his humble beginnings.
The Raiders Years: Building a Foundation
Jacobs signed his rookie contract with the Raiders in 2019 — a four-year deal worth approximately $12 million, including a $6.7 million signing bonus. He made an immediate impact, rushing for 1,150 yards and seven touchdowns as a rookie, earning PFWA All-Rookie Team honors. His success continued in 2020 when he rushed for 1,065 yards and 12 touchdowns, earning his first Pro Bowl selection.
The 2022 season proved to be Jacobs' breakout campaign. He led the NFL in rushing with 1,653 yards and added 12 touchdowns, earning First-Team All-Pro honors and his second Pro Bowl nod. That performance forced the Raiders' hand, and in August 2023, he signed a restructured one-year contract worth $11.791 million after a brief holdout.
The Green Bay Payday: A $48 Million Commitment
In March 2024, Josh Jacobs hit the free-agent market and landed a massive four-year, $48 million contract with the Green Bay Packers. The deal included a $12.5 million signing bonus and $12.5 million in guaranteed money, with an average annual salary of $12 million. For the 2025 season, his combined base salary, roster bonus, and workout incentives total approximately $8.2 million, making him one of the highest-paid running backs in the league.
According to Spotrac, Jacobs' career earnings through the 2026 season surpass $46.8 million, a testament to his sustained excellence and value at a position that has increasingly been devalued in the modern NFL.
Endorsements and Off-Field Income
Jacobs' net worth is not solely built on his NFL salary. He has partnered with several major brands that have significantly boosted his income. His endorsement portfolio includes Nike, Wilson, Tide, Kia, Panini, Bose, DraftKings, and Snickers. These partnerships have added millions to his overall earnings and helped establish his brand beyond football.
Jacobs has also proven to be a savvy investor. He has invested in real estate and built an impressive luxury car collection, including a prized Carroll Shelby. His financial discipline and willingness to plan for life after football demonstrate a maturity that many young athletes lack.

Career Highlights and Achievements
Jacobs' on-field accomplishments help explain his earning power. He is a three-time Pro Bowl selection (2020, 2022, 2024) and was named First-Team All-Pro in 2022 after leading the NFL in rushing. Through the 2025 season, Jacobs ranks No. 2 in the NFL in rushing yards since 2019 with 6,874 rushing yards and 61 rushing touchdowns. He has started 95 of 105 career games and has been one of the most durable and productive running backs of his generation.
